Product Introduction

Overview

The NB100ELT23L is a dual differential LVPECL/LVDS to LVTTL translator produced by onsemi. This device is designed to translate clock and data signals from LVPECL (Positive ECL) or LVDS levels to LVTTL levels, requiring only a +3.3 V power supply and ground. The small outline 8-lead package and dual gate design make it ideal for applications needing the translation of both clock and data signals. The ELT23L operates within the ECL 100K standard and does not require LVPECL outputs or an external VBB reference, making it versatile for various differential LVPECL inputs referenced from a VCC of +3.3 V.

Key Specifications

Parameter Condition Min Typ Max Unit
VCC Power Supply GND = 0 V - - 3.8 V
VI Input Voltage GND = 0 V, VI ≤ VCC - - 3.8 V
Iout Output Current Continuous - - 50 mA
Iout Output Current Surge - - 100 mA
TA Operating Temperature Range - -40 - 85 °C
Tstg Storage Temperature Range - -65 - 150 °C
fmax Maximum Frequency - 160 - - MHz
tPLH, tPHL Propagation Delay to Output Differential CL = 20 pF 1.55 1.9 2.95 ns
VOH Output HIGH Voltage IOH = −3.0 mA 2.4 - - V
VOL Output LOW Voltage IOL = 24 mA 0.5 - - V

Key Features

  • 2.1 ns Typical Propagation Delay
  • Maximum Operating Frequency > 160 MHz
  • 24 mA LVTTL Outputs
  • Operating Range: VCC = 3.0 V to 3.6 V with GND = 0 V
  • Differential LVPECL Inputs compatible with standard differential LVPECL/LVDS inputs
  • Internal Input Pulldown and Pullup Resistors
  • ESD Protection: Human Body Model > 1.5 kV, Machine Model > 100 V, Charged Device Model > 2 kV
  • Pb-Free, Halogen Free/BFR Free, and RoHS Compliant
